Right here's the final tutorial about our recreational vehicle that was amounted to a week after we finished renovations, and it's everything about. We will certainly cover just how to get rid of the previous rug and linoleum, picking the appropriate flooring for a MOTOR HOME, preparing to mount floor covering (specifically when you discover shocks under the old stuff), and ultimately exactly how to set up motor home flooring.
It was in good form, yet rug in a Motor home is simply not practical, particularly in a Motor home with two canines. The kitchen location and restroom floor were linoleum.
Getting rid of the rug and linoleum didn't take much effort given that neither were glued down. We just reduced with the material with a linoleum knife and utilized some muscular tissue to pull it up. A shock was concealed behind the carpet on the steps an air vent for the heater! Why on earth would certainly someone carpet over that? The heater was not as effective as anticipated during the winter, and a RV repair service professional suggested setting up a fourth air vent to accommodate the size of the unit, which we did.
2nd surprise was a gaping opening where the slide including the entertainment facility meets the floor. Our ideal assumption is that there was a tire blowout at some factor that created the damages. Rather of repairing it properly, the previous owners covered it with carpet. Remarkable. The picture over shows the hole repaired with 2 x 4 sized to fit.
There were THAT numerous! Dave's approach of staple removal included a huge screwdriver and a hammer. I chose utilizing vise-grips such as this. Shaking it backward and forward was easier on the wrist. A great pair of work gloves was useful as well. Thank goodness the infant had not been mobile. Keep in mind: The black liner around the recreational vehicle's slides need to be left in tact and stapled.
Finally we were down to a tidy sub-floor and all set to install the new things. Clearly we really did not desire carpeting in the living location, so our floor covering choices were limited to vinyl planks, sheet vinyl, linoleum, peel-and-stick ceramic tiles, and cork. We had success with peel-and-stick tiles in our very first RV however desired to attempt something brand-new.
Several RV blog owners have mounted vinyl planks in their rigs, the kind that snap right into area. After A Whole lot of research, we found that concerning half of them loved their floorings.
We likewise took into factor to consider that we weren't going to maintain the Recreational vehicle lasting. A Recreational vehicle flooring option must be affordable and appeal to the masses for resale.
We mention this because the floor covering decision appeared like a large deal at the time. The ethical right here is to purchase what makes you delighted due to the fact that it may be taken away from you tomorrow.
We were happy to find books upon publications of examples at a regional floor covering supply shop. Simply so you understand, these kinds of shops usually will not mount floor covering in a RECREATIONAL VEHICLE. They will certainly buy the product, however you are accountable for setup. For the layout, we selected Havana by Benchmark.
This shop used the vinyl in differing thicknesses to tailor the comfort level. Considering we stayed in the RV and the brand-new buyers could as well, we went with a deluxe option. It was shockingly budget-friendly at $0.80 per square foot! To figure out just how much plastic to buy, we drew a diagram of the motor home's measurements to include the slides.
After subtracting video for that, we established we required 354 square feet of floor covering. The illustration on the reduced half of the paper reveals how we separated a 12-foot sheet to fit all the nooks and crannies in the Recreational vehicle.
Total expense with tax obligations and charges was $326.94. We selected it up with the motor home in tow so we didn't have to tinker strapping it to the truck and running the risk of wrinkling or harming the flooring. On the installation! Pick a warm day to set up. You only need one.
Hopefully you have grass or a clean concrete pad to work on. The illustration was helpful for determining just how much flooring to acquire, yet take direct dimensions in the Recreational vehicle for this part.

I wish he could travel with us! Fold up the flooring onto itself to obtain it back right into the recreational vehicle. It was not heavy in all. Clear the very first location for installation. We operated in areas, beginning with the large slide, instead of cleaning out the entire rig. If you prefer order over turmoil, move every little thing out.
After laying the floor covering, make precision cuts with an utility knife. A floating floor will certainly allow for more motion during traveling. Do not standard along the front of the slide.
Next we moved to the facility of the Recreational vehicle. The bigger piece of floor covering was more of a difficulty to obtain into location however certainly manageable with 2 individuals.
Just how to manage the front of the slides was a little an enigma when we started this job. We weren't sure if we would certainly put an item of trim throughout it or something similar, but it looked wonderful by itself. The slides were moved in and out several times throughout our trip across the country, and they glided completely without leaving a mark.
We delighted in the Motor home floor covering extremely much while we can and advise this task to any RVer. When it was all claimed and done it took around an afternoon. It's an embarassment we didn't obtain to enjoy the new floor covering in our Motor home much longer.

ISSUE: The bathroom was not firm on the floor. I removed the toilet from the floor and discovered the flange gasket undamaged yet the floor decomposed around the commode flange. When removing the bathroom, I located the water installation hung at the commode. This allowed water to diminish the supply line, drip onto the floor, and run hidden over the side of the vinyl right into the flange area of the floor.
